Ortwin Gentz
From Cocoapedia
Ortwin Gentz is founder and lead developer of the iPhone app development company FutureTap. He's based in Seefeld at the south-western outskirts of Munich, Germany.

[edit] Biography
Ortwin Gentz is a long-time Mac user, his first one was a Mac LC running System 6.0.7. After finishing his diploma in computer science at TU Munich he cofounded the Mac software vendor equinux, in 1999. After nearly 10 years the former founders went separate ways and Gentz founded FutureTap. Being a two-time Apple Design Awards winner[1], Gentz is passionate about combining rich functionality with gorgeous user interface design.
[edit] Apps
- Where To? – GPS Points of Interest, originally developed by tap tap tap, Gentz/FutureTap acquired[2] the app in 2008, brought it back to the App Store and has since then developed two new major versions.
[edit] Open Source projects
- InAppSettingsKit: framework to display a settings in-app in addition to the Settings app, developed together with Luc Vandal
- FTLocationSimulator: simulate Core Location updates in the iPhone simulator
- iTunesFeaturedCheck: small script to scrape featured entries from the App Store
